Comparative Analysis of HIV Risk Perceptions and Knowledge Among Ex-Offenders from Canada, France, the Ivory Coast and South Africa

The present paper states the preliminary results of our research project conducted with ex-prisoners from four countries (Canada, France, Ivory Coast and South Africa). The goal of the project was to explore and compare the psychosocial determinants of HIV and Hepatitis C Virus (HCV) risk behaviours among ex-offenders from the four countries (Project SSHRC -FII-861-2007-1019: Vallières et al. 2007).  

Two studies were carried out in each country: a pilot study, conducted by interviewing a small number of ex-offenders, and a more extensive field study that used a self-report questionnaire with ex-offenders and a control group. The present paper will focus on the results obtained in the field study.  The study involved around 260 participants – about half ex-prisoners and the other half control participants between 21 and 50 years of age. We will present results relative on the type of information ex-offenders participants received, the level of their knowledge about HIV/AIDS and HCV, modes of transmission, etc. Comparison of the results obtained for each country will also be presented and discussed. 

Evelyne Vallières is professor in psychology since 1999 at Télé-université, Université du Québec à Montréal. After graduating, she worked as a research manager for Correctional Service of Canada and then as an institutional researcher at l’Université du Québec à Montréal. Her research interests and work has been in the field of offending, victimization, risky driving and risky behaviours related to health (e.g. HIV and STI) in a transcultural perspective.
